After the institution of Sydney in 1788, settlement from the North Shore from the harbour was fairly restricted. One of many very first settlers was James Milson who lived within the vicinity of Jeffrey Avenue in Kirribilli, straight reverse Sydney Cove. The north shore was more rugged than the southern shore and western areas of the harbour and had confined agricultural prospective.

The "Upper North Shore" typically refers to the suburbs amongst Roseville and Hornsby, north-west of your Sydney CBD. It is created up in the handful of suburbs Situated throughout the Ku-ring-gai and Hornsby Shire councils. The affluent region is noted for its clean up leafy streets, stately households and superior assets prices. Nevertheless the realm is going through important changes with enhanced urban density along the railway and vegetation clearing Considering that the introduction from the point out governments ten/50 tree clearing laws.

The early functions in top article the area provided tree felling, boatbuilding and some orchard farming during the confined parts of fantastic soil. The North Shore railway line was built in the 1890s. Usage of the Sydney CBD, Found within the southern shore in the harbour remained complicated right up until the completion from the Sydney Harbour Bridge in 1932. This resulted in commencement the event of suburbs over the North Shore.[citation required]

Not all of the railway stations over the Upper and Reduce North Shore have wheelchair/pram use of allow for easy accessibility towards the System (which include ramps or lifts). Stations around the North Shore with no this entry are: Roseville, Killara, Pymble, Warrawee, Wahroonga and Waitara. When Wollstonecraft does Possess a gradual moved here declining path It truly is highly recommended for wheelchair users to phone the station since the hole for the train normally requires A further ramp to permit access to the train.
